Directions:

  1. Cake:
  2. Sift first three ingredients together in a separate bowl
  3. Beat eggs in mixing bowl with mixer on high speed until thick
  4. Add sugar gradually, beting well after each addition
  5. Stir in vanilla extract
  6. Gently fold in the flour mixture just until blended
  7. Spread evenly in buttered 10 x15 jelly roll pan lined with buttered and floured waxed paper
  8. Bake at 375 degrees for 8-10 minutes
  9. Remove cake from oven and turn out onto a tea towel sprinkled liberally with powdered sugar
  10. Peel waxed paper off the bottom of the cake
  11. Roll up the cake in the towel as for jelly roll (start rolling from the 15 side of the cake, your towel will roll right along with the cake)
  12. Let stand for 20 minutes to cool
  13. Filling:
  14. Soften gelatin in 1/4 cup water in saucepan
  15. Cook over low heat until dissolved, stirring constantly; cool
  16. Fold cooled gelatin and powdered sugar into whipped cream
  17. Chill covered for 5-10 minutes
  18. Unroll cake and spread with filling
  19. Spoon 3/4 cup sliced fresh strawberries over the top
  20. Roll up cake, removing towel
  21. Chill for 1 hour or longer
  22. Top with remaining whipped cream and whole strawberries
